Why are some mineral licks not suitable for ram lambs?

    rangler1 wrote: »
    obviously something in them that harms ram lambs, example magnesium or even calcium can cause kidney stone which'll kill them if they can't pass them

    Mainly the calcium that might cause uninary calci. Most of them would be safe enough as long as the rams aren't on an intensive diet
